Estimate the quotient: 16 3/4 divided by 4 2/3. Show your work.

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

First turn them into improper fractions.

16 3/4 ----> 67/4

4 2/3 -----> 14/3

67/4÷14/3= ?

Now use keep, change, flip strategy

67/4×3/14= 201/56

Now simplify 3 33/56
